Artemis | Andy Weir
post image
Pickpick

Andy Weir may be an auto-read for me at this point, and I‘m not sure I can say that about any other scifi author.

This one is a heist in a lunar colony. Jazz is hired to sabotage the smelting company on the moon so a billionaire can take over their contract with the lunar government. Of course things don‘t go as she planned, and a fast paced race to avoid the law, a mafia, and save the day ensue.

Projects Hail Mary is still my AW fave, but 👍👍.
